I 'was' a forces sweetheart - I wrote some years ago in response to an article in a woman's magazine asking for pen-pals for guys in the Gulf war - going back to the 1990's...I wrote a 'bluey' and addressed it to 'any soldier' etc - my dh received it and after many weeks found the courage to write back....by which time he'd gone back to his base in Germany after the Gulf War had finished. He then came back to the UK and we met on a blind date....I can remember he was extremely nervous. He was going through a messy divorce at the time and was very much 'once bitten, twice shy'....

We married in 1994, have two children and we're very happy!
